Jack Grigg
|
df70f410f3
|
Assigned ZIP number 213
|
2019-05-02 11:50:06 +01:00 |
Jack Grigg
|
fcb49762f1
|
Address Daira's comments
|
2019-05-02 11:49:14 +01:00 |
Jack Grigg
|
845ca0f811
|
Draft ZIP: Shielded Coinbase
Part of https://github.com/zcash/zcash/issues/2488
|
2019-03-30 04:47:27 -03:00 |
Daira Hopwood
|
10b35bdd19
|
Remove obsolete draft version of ZIP 0 (superseded by #206).
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-03-20 01:42:40 +00:00 |
str4d
|
9c65d64012
|
Merge pull request #209 from str4d/zips-207-208
Update protocol spec with ZIPs 207 and 208
|
2019-03-08 17:59:17 +13:00 |
Daira Hopwood
|
ce803ea0b4
|
Correct generators for BLS12-381.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-24 05:59:14 +00:00 |
Daira Hopwood
|
86319cfe89
|
Address Daira's review comments.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-24 02:06:23 +00:00 |
Daira Hopwood
|
5cf59663d9
|
Cosmetics.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-24 02:05:58 +00:00 |
Daira Hopwood
|
4284a49a20
|
Add bibliography entries for ZIPs 207 and 208.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-24 02:02:54 +00:00 |
Daira Hopwood
|
fa41eae110
|
Fix a Makefile bug.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-24 02:02:16 +00:00 |
Jack Grigg
|
d6ed011d5e
|
ZIP 207 changes
|
2019-02-23 19:21:19 +00:00 |
Jack Grigg
|
2fc1b8cc9c
|
ZIP 208 changes
Includes additional changes to constants in sections 7.7 and 7.8 which
are needed to compile, and not part of ZIP 208, but will be altered by
ZIP 207.
|
2019-02-23 19:21:17 +00:00 |
Daira Hopwood
|
4a9eb35910
|
ZIP 32: fill in links to reference implementation.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 22:54:16 +00:00 |
Daira Hopwood
|
d7d12b82b5
|
ZIP 243: add a missing reference.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 22:53:34 +00:00 |
Daira Hopwood
|
34967ee7c5
|
ZIP 143: Clarify testing for SIGHASH_SINGLE and SIGHASH_NONE. fixes #169
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 16:03:10 +00:00 |
Daira Hopwood
|
e01760a60d
|
ZIP 243: fix broken links, and clarify that test vectors do not necessarily pass full validation.
fixes #188, #193
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 15:52:13 +00:00 |
Daira Hopwood
|
1fa1a91f32
|
Regenerate PDFs (including the new blossom.pdf).
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 13:54:50 +00:00 |
Daira Hopwood
|
5097fc7c4e
|
Add macros and Makefile support for building the Blossom specification.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 13:49:08 +00:00 |
Daira Hopwood
|
7f435cd37d
|
Fix a typo in appendix B.2 and clarify the costs of Groth16 batch verification.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 13:49:08 +00:00 |
Daira Hopwood
|
f3c5ed99e2
|
Remove the rule that miners SHOULD NOT mine blocks that chain to other blocks with version number > 4.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 13:49:08 +00:00 |
Daira Hopwood
|
06725e94b9
|
Correct the rule about when a transaction is permitted to have no transparent inputs.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 13:34:25 +00:00 |
Daira Hopwood
|
95d95bc4c4
|
Clarify which transaction fields are added by Overwinter and Sapling.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 13:33:39 +00:00 |
Daira Hopwood
|
8e9171d512
|
Clarify that Equihash is based on a *variation* of the GBP, and cite [AR2017].
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 13:17:07 +00:00 |
Daira Hopwood
|
c57d51d7a0
|
More references and corrected description of Groth16.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-22 12:49:22 +00:00 |
Daira Hopwood
|
0b626b087a
|
Regenerate PDFs.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-10 03:30:26 +00:00 |
Daira Hopwood
|
ba949107ab
|
Correct isis agora lovecruft's name.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-10 03:20:47 +00:00 |
Daira Hopwood
|
2dc3a10bfe
|
Regenerate PDFs.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-09 01:02:01 +00:00 |
Daira Hopwood
|
64c268fdd7
|
Add Eirik Ogilvie-Wigley and Benjamin Winston to acknowledgements.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-09 01:00:03 +00:00 |
Daira Hopwood
|
fb9faa3835
|
Cosmetics.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-09 00:37:00 +00:00 |
Daira Hopwood
|
0988966fdc
|
Remaining fixes and clarifications for BCTV14 vulnerability.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-09 00:37:00 +00:00 |
Daira Hopwood
|
e17905a0a3
|
Specify the difficulty adjustment change on testnet.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-09 00:37:00 +00:00 |
Daira Hopwood
|
d4a9158323
|
Say when Sapling activated, and reference ZIP 205.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-09 00:37:00 +00:00 |
Daira Hopwood
|
d18edb4abc
|
Rename zk-SNARK Parameters sections according to the proving system.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-08 22:59:38 +00:00 |
Daira Hopwood
|
0d8430799c
|
Correct [SBB2019] to [SWB2019], and note that the BCTV14 vulnerability affected Soundness.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-05 19:29:31 +00:00 |
Daira Hopwood
|
36eeeba15e
|
Regenerate PDFs.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-05 16:55:42 +00:00 |
Daira Hopwood
|
9a7ebd326e
|
Disclose BCTV14 vulnerability.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2019-02-05 16:45:09 +00:00 |
Daira Hopwood
|
9515d73aac
|
Regenerate PDFs.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-11-14 02:05:26 +00:00 |
Daira Hopwood
|
680af418cf
|
Fill in another constraint cost.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-11-14 02:02:17 +00:00 |
Daira Hopwood
|
af17ba2485
|
Adjust the notation used for scalar multiplication in Appendix A to allow bit sequences as scalars.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-11-14 02:01:59 +00:00 |
Daira Hopwood
|
9aba6af281
|
Cosmetics.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-11-14 02:01:01 +00:00 |
Daira Hopwood
|
538d1f1eb0
|
Add a description of the Sapling output circuit.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-11-14 01:05:39 +00:00 |
Daira Hopwood
|
79b3d81e42
|
Complete the description of the Sapling spend circuit.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-11-13 23:15:54 +00:00 |
Daira Hopwood
|
5531006f08
|
Fix or complete various calculations of constraint costs.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-11-13 23:11:53 +00:00 |
Daira Hopwood
|
7419c0a366
|
Describe 2-bit window lookup with conditional negation.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-11-13 23:09:34 +00:00 |
Daira Hopwood
|
39b498fed9
|
Remove a todo.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-11-13 22:07:18 +00:00 |
Daira Hopwood
|
0835c3837e
|
Modify the description of fixed-base scalar multiplication to match sapling-crypto.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-11-13 22:06:36 +00:00 |
Daira Hopwood
|
2f868aca8d
|
Add LEBStoIP.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-11-13 22:00:41 +00:00 |
Daira Hopwood
|
c7d08a269c
|
ZIP 205 formatting fixes.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-10-30 20:43:30 +00:00 |
Daira Hopwood
|
e4a74b9d0e
|
Merge pull request #191 from daira/zip-0205
Add ZIP 205.
|
2018-10-29 01:13:22 +00:00 |
Daira Hopwood
|
ede1215566
|
Add ZIP 205.
Signed-off-by: Daira Hopwood <daira@jacaranda.org>
|
2018-10-28 07:43:31 +00:00 |